SDDM will run on xorg by default and most session settings will only be loadable after having selected a session/logging into a wayland session from Xorg started SDDM mandates a modeset switch anyway.
Offhand I'd suggest trying to setup SDDM for a wayland start e.g. https://wiki.archlinux.org/title/SDDM#Wayland and see the section mentioning how to match Plasma's display settings.
